Description

13 Going on 30 is a romantic comedy film that was released in 2004. The film was directed by Gary Winick and stars Jennifer Garner and Mark Ruffalo. The story follows the life of Jenna Rink, a thirteen-year-old girl who wishes to be a thirty-year-old woman, and wakes up to find that her wish has come true.

The film explores themes of friendship, love, and self-discovery as Jenna navigates her new life as a successful magazine editor. She is initially thrilled to be living her dream life, but soon realizes that the choices she made have caused her to lose touch with her true self and her childhood friend, Matt. Jenna must find a way to reconnect with her past and rediscover what is truly important to her.

13 Going on 30 is a charming and lighthearted film that will appeal to fans of romantic comedies. The film's themes of self-discovery and personal growth are timeless and relatable, and its talented cast brings the characters to life with humor and heart. The film's soundtrack, which features popular songs from the 80s, adds to the film's nostalgic feel and makes it a fun and enjoyable watch.

Released in 2012, Diary of a Wimpy Kid: Dog Days covers the events depicted in third and fourth books of Jeff Kinney: The Last Straw and Dog Days. The last one "realistic fiction" novel got more attention from Wallace Wolodarsky who wrote a screenplay for the movie, and this fact is noticeably reflected in the film's plot. The storyline begins with Greg Heffley and Rowley Jefferson are going to the country club for their summer vacations where due to the unfortunate sequence of developments both of them got into the troubles. Bleak outlook of spending the summer in vain efforts to make some money is rising at the horizon with more and more of clarity. That makes the movie very similar to previous two: Diary of a Wimpy Kid (2010) and Diary of a Wimpy Kid: Rodrick Rules (2011) – the hopeless children are showcased as losers trying to do their best. Nevertheless, the play of the cast is outstanding as usual and while watching this sequel you distinctively understand why these seven actor and actress (Zachary Gordon, Karan Brar, Robert Capron, Laine MacNeil, Connor & Owen Fielding and Dalila Bela were nominated the Young Artist Award and some of them ( we mean Laine MacNeil) even won it.
